Mesothelioma Attorney

An attorney for mesothelioma can assist the victims and their families in filing an action for financial compensation. There are a variety of mesothelioma lawsuits, including those for personal injury and wrongful death.

Mesothelioma attorneys must have expertise in asbestos litigation and should be knowledgeable of asbestos laws from multiple states. National firms are able to file your case in the state or state that is most advantageous for your case.

Experience

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will be well-versed in asbestos litigation and have a vast experience handling these types of claims. They must have a track of accomplishments, including notable settlements and verdicts by juries. They should be able to explain the different options available for pursuing compensation, such as filing a lawsuit or obtaining an organized settlement.

The knowledge of the Law

The lawyers you choose to work with must be knowledgeable of asbestos laws and how they relate to your specific case. They must also be able to explain complex legal concepts in easy-to-understand terms.

The top mesothelioma law firms have a proven track record of obtaining compensation for their clients. The compensation is intended to help victims and their families pay for medical treatments as well as manage the loss of wages and cover the costs of in-home nursing care.

Asbestos lawsuits can be complicated and involve multiple parties. A good mesothelioma lawyer should know how to collaborate with medical experts, insurance companies and financial institutions to obtain the best results for their clients.

Some cases settle without a trial, while others go to trial. The best lawyers have experience in both types of trials, and will develop a strategy based on your case's strength of evidence.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have a track record of success, obtaining significant settlements and verdicts. They have the experience and the ability to take on large corporations that exposed their employees to asbestos. Attorneys from the national firm Weitz & Luxenberg have, for instance, reached multimillion-dollar settlements on behalf of their clients. They recently won a $13 million settlement against Colgate-Palmolive for a woman suffering from mesothelioma as a result of using the company's popular Cashmere Bouquet talcum powder.

The role of a mesothelioma lawyer is to assist clients with filing legal claims and fight for maximum compensation. They will help with preparing medical records and working with insurance companies. A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will also ensure that the victim's rights are protected throughout the process. Many attorneys offer no-obligation, no-cost consultations regarding mesothelioma.

Settlements

Mesothelioma compensation may help a family pay for medical treatments and other costs. A successful claim could also be used to pay for funeral expenses, lost wages, future loss of income, legal costs as well as suffering and pain. Mesothelioma lawyers are knowledgeable about the intricacies of asbestos litigation, and can assist with filing claims for damages.

Lawyers who have experience in mesothelioma might be able to pinpoint potential sources of exposure quickly. This information can later be used to build mesothelioma claims against asbestos-related companies and the manufacturers accountable for the exposure. The attorneys at law firms that specialize in asbestos litigation know the best method to obtain compensation from the defendants.

A mesothelioma cancer case that is successful typically results in a settlement. In some instances trials may be necessary to ensure that the victim receives fair amount of compensation. Mesothelioma patients and their families should have access to a lawyer who is skilled in the preparation of trials, and has secured compensation for his clients.

A mesothelioma lawyer firm in the United States can assist asbestos victims and their families know their rights and file a mesothelioma lawsuit. They have worked with local courts and decide where lawsuits can be filed based on laws and statutes in every state. They have the capacity to employ experts, such as industrial hygienists as well as physicians and can manage all aspects of a mesothelioma lawsuit on behalf of their clients. They can also assist in receiving benefits from trust funds and other sources of compensation. They can also aid in appeals in the event that the settlement is not reached. Their clients can then focus on their treatment and families. They can also assist in filing for workers' compensation, if they are eligible.
